Brooklyn’s Pizza Gods Broke Bread Together

This is like the pizza equivalent of that time St. Vincent made an album with David Byrne. Last night, the Pizza-father himself Dom DeMarco of Di Fara, Brooklyn’s most classic pizzeria, apparently ate dinner at Lucali, Brooklyn’s coolest, and some would argue best, pizzeria. Lucali’s Mark Iacono ‘grammed a black-and-white of himself talking with DeMarco at the table. It’s not clear what they were talking about, though likely topics include not messing with Italian food, hooligans who put pineapple on pizza, and the nice bottle of amaro they seem to have cracked open.
